### 5.7x28mm: A High-Velocity Contender

The 5.7x28mm, developed by FN Herstal, was initially designed for the P90 personal defense weapon and the Five-seveN pistol. Its defining characteristic is its high velocity and flat trajectory. The cartridge features a small-diameter bullet, typically around 40 grains, propelled at speeds exceeding 2,000 feet per second. This high velocity translates into significant energy on target and a reduced bullet drop over distance. The 5.7x28mm was initially conceived to offer a cartridge with greater range, accuracy, and penetration than 9mm when fired from a short-barreled firearm, offering a flatter trajectory and armor-piercing capabilities.

Its design allows for high magazine capacity in firearms designed for it. The cartridge’s lighter weight also contributes to a lighter overall weapon system, which can be advantageous in certain tactical situations. The 5.7x28mm is often viewed as a specialized cartridge, excelling in specific scenarios where its unique characteristics offer a distinct advantage.

### 9mm: The Ubiquitous Standard

The 9mm, also known as 9x19mm Parabellum, is arguably the most popular handgun cartridge in the world. Its widespread adoption stems from its balance of power, manageable recoil, and relatively low cost. Developed in the early 20th century, the 9mm has become a staple in military, law enforcement, and civilian applications. Its versatility is evident in its use in a wide range of firearms, from compact pistols to submachine guns.

The 9mm typically fires bullets ranging from 115 to 147 grains, with velocities varying depending on the specific load. While not as high-velocity as the 5.7x28mm, the 9mm delivers sufficient energy for effective self-defense and is known for its accuracy and reliability. Its popularity has led to a vast array of ammunition options, catering to various needs and preferences. It represents a very mature and refined platform, with nearly limitless options for firearms and ammunition.

### Core Differences: Velocity, Energy, and Recoil

The most significant differences between the two cartridges lie in their velocity, energy, and recoil characteristics. The 5.7x28mm boasts a significantly higher velocity, resulting in a flatter trajectory and potentially greater penetration against certain materials. However, the 9mm generally delivers more energy on target, especially with heavier bullet weights. Recoil is another key factor, with the 5.7x28mm typically generating less felt recoil than the 9mm, making it easier to control and shoot accurately, particularly for less experienced shooters. It is important to note that perceived recoil is subjective and can vary depending on the firearm and individual shooter. In our testing, many found the 5.7x28mm to be significantly easier to control in rapid-fire scenarios.

### Understanding Ballistic Performance

Ballistic performance is a crucial aspect when comparing the 5.7x28mm vs 9mm. Several factors, including bullet weight, velocity, and ballistic coefficient, influence a cartridge’s trajectory, energy, and penetration. The 5.7x28mm’s high velocity contributes to a flatter trajectory, meaning the bullet drops less over distance, making it easier to aim accurately at longer ranges. However, the 9mm’s heavier bullets often retain more energy downrange, potentially delivering more stopping power.

Penetration is another critical consideration, particularly for self-defense applications. Both cartridges are capable of penetrating common barriers, but their performance can vary depending on the specific ammunition used. The 5.7x28mm’s high velocity can aid in penetrating hard targets, while the 9mm’s heavier bullets may offer better penetration against softer targets. In our experience, ammunition selection is paramount in optimizing penetration performance.

## Significant Advantages, Benefits & Real-World Value of 5.7x28mm vs 9mm

### 5.7x28mm: Advantages and Benefits

* **Flatter Trajectory:** The high velocity of the 5.7x28mm results in a flatter trajectory, making it easier to aim accurately at longer ranges. This is particularly beneficial in scenarios where precise shot placement is crucial.
* **Reduced Recoil:** The 5.7x28mm generates less felt recoil than the 9mm, making it easier to control and shoot accurately, especially for less experienced shooters. This can lead to faster follow-up shots and improved overall accuracy.
* **High Magazine Capacity:** Firearms chambered in 5.7x28mm often have higher magazine capacities than those chambered in 9mm, providing a greater number of rounds available in a single magazine. This can be advantageous in situations requiring sustained fire.
* **Potential for Armor Penetration:** The 5.7x28mm’s high velocity and small bullet diameter can aid in penetrating certain types of body armor, although this depends on the specific ammunition used. In our simulated tests, certain 5.7x28mm loads showed improved penetration against Level IIIA armor compared to standard 9mm.
* **Lightweight Ammunition:** The 5.7x28mm cartridge is lighter than the 9mm, allowing users to carry more ammunition with less weight. This can be a significant advantage for those who need to carry a large number of rounds.

### 9mm: Advantages and Benefits

* **Widespread Availability:** The 9mm is the most popular handgun cartridge in the world, making it readily available in a wide variety of ammunition types and price points. This ensures that users can easily find ammunition to suit their needs and budget.
* **Lower Cost:** 9mm ammunition is generally less expensive than 5.7x28mm ammunition, making it more affordable for training and practice. This allows users to spend more time honing their skills without breaking the bank.
* **Versatile Performance:** The 9mm offers a good balance of power, accuracy, and recoil, making it suitable for a wide range of applications, from self-defense to target shooting. Its versatility makes it a popular choice for both beginners and experienced shooters.
* **Proven Track Record:** The 9mm has a long and successful track record in military, law enforcement, and civilian applications. Its proven reliability and effectiveness have made it a trusted choice for decades.
* **Wide Firearm Selection:** There is a vast selection of firearms chambered in 9mm, ranging from compact pistols to full-size handguns and even pistol-caliber carbines. This allows users to choose a firearm that best suits their individual needs and preferences.

**Q1: What is the effective range difference between 5.7x28mm and 9mm in a handgun?**

**A:** While both cartridges are effective at typical self-defense distances (0-25 yards), the 5.7x28mm generally exhibits a flatter trajectory, making it slightly easier to achieve accurate hits at the upper end of that range and beyond. However, practical accuracy depends heavily on the shooter’s skill and the specific firearm.

**Q2: How does the cost of ownership compare between a 5.7x28mm firearm and a 9mm firearm, considering ammunition and maintenance?**

**A:** The initial cost of a 5.7x28mm firearm can be higher than a comparable 9mm model. Furthermore, 5.7x28mm ammunition is typically more expensive than 9mm. Maintenance costs are generally similar, but the higher ammunition cost makes the 9mm a more economical choice for frequent shooters.

**Q3: Are there any significant differences in the availability of accessories (holsters, magazines, etc.) for 5.7x28mm vs 9mm firearms?**

**A:** 9mm firearms, particularly popular models like the Glock 19, have a significantly larger aftermarket support. You’ll find a wider variety of holsters, magazines, and other accessories for 9mm firearms compared to 5.7x28mm models.

**Q4: How does the 5.7x28mm perform against common barriers (e.g., car doors, drywall) compared to the 9mm?**

**A:** Both cartridges can penetrate common barriers, but their performance can vary depending on the specific ammunition used. The 5.7x28mm’s high velocity can aid in penetrating hard barriers, while the 9mm’s heavier bullets may offer better penetration against softer barriers. However, barrier penetration is a complex topic, and testing is always recommended for specific scenarios.

**Q5: What are the legal considerations regarding the 5.7x28mm, particularly concerning armor-piercing ammunition?**

**A:** Some 5.7x28mm ammunition has been classified as armor-piercing under certain legal definitions. It’s crucial to understand and comply with all applicable federal, state, and local laws regarding ammunition ownership and use. Always consult with legal counsel if you have any questions.

**Q6: How does the recoil impulse differ between 5.7x28mm and 9mm, and how does this affect shooter fatigue during extended training sessions?**

**A:** The 5.7x28mm generally produces a sharper, quicker recoil impulse, while the 9mm’s recoil is often described as a more prolonged push. While the 5.7x28mm has less overall felt recoil, some shooters may find the sharper impulse more fatiguing over extended training sessions. Individual preferences vary.

**Q7: What are some common misconceptions about the 5.7x28mm, and how do they compare to the realities of its performance?**

**A:** A common misconception is that the 5.7x28mm is a “magic bullet” with exceptional armor-piercing capabilities. While it can penetrate certain types of body armor, its performance is not universally superior to other cartridges, and its effectiveness depends heavily on the specific ammunition used. Another misconception is that it lacks stopping power, which is not necessarily true with appropriate ammunition selection.

**Q8: How does the 5.7x28mm perform in short-barreled pistols compared to the 9mm?**

**A:** The 5.7x28mm was originally designed for short-barreled firearms like the FN P90. It tends to maintain its velocity better in shorter barrels compared to the 9mm, making it potentially more effective in compact pistols. However, the 9mm still offers adequate performance in short-barreled platforms.
